Political Science is the 13th most popular major in the country with 47,549 degrees awarded in 2020-2021.

Across the Rocky Mountains region, there were 1,635 political science gra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ively.

This year’s “Best Value Poly Sci Schools in the Rocky Mountains Region For Those Making $30-$48k” ranking analyzed 25 colleges that offered a degree in political science. Not only do the schools that top this list have excellent political science programs, but they also cost less that schools of similar quality.

Some of the factors we look at when determining these rankings are overall quality of the political science program at the school and the cost of the school after aid is awarded among other things. For more information, check out our ranking methodology.

1
Colorado College crest
Colorado College
Colorado Springs, Colorado

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end Colorado College. The school came in at #1 for the Best Value Poly Sci Schools in the Rocky Mountains Region For Those Making $30-$48k. This small school is located in Colorado Springs, Colorado, and it awarded 40 ’s poly sci degrees in 2020-2021.

Colorado College also took the #5 spot in our “Best Political Science Schools in the Rocky Mountains Region” ranking. The yearly cost to attend Colorado College is $8,602 for Rocky Mountains Region Poly Sci students whose families make $30-$48k.

The impressive undergraduate student-to-faculty ratio of 9 to 1 means that students may have more opportunities to work more closely with their professors than they would at other schools. The low undergrad student loan default rate of 0.5%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%. The school has an excellent freshman retention rate of 86%, which means students like the school well enough to return for a second year.
